[jboss-cvs] JBossAS SVN: r82666 - projects/webbeans-ri-int/trunk/microcontainer/src/main/java/org/jboss/webbeans/integration/microcontainer/deployer/metadata.
jboss-cvs-commits at lists.jboss.org
jboss-cvs-commits at lists.jboss.org
Wed Jan 7 12:18:25 EST 2009
Author: alesj
Date: 2009-01-07 12:18:25 -0500 (Wed, 07 Jan 2009)
New Revision: 82666
Modified:
projects/webbeans-ri-int/trunk/microcontainer/src/main/java/org/jboss/webbeans/integration/microcontainer/deployer/metadata/PostWebMetadataDeployer.java
projects/webbeans-ri-int/trunk/microcontainer/src/main/java/org/jboss/webbeans/integration/microcontainer/deployer/metadata/WBEjbInterceptorMetadataDeployer.java
Log:
Use annotation/scanned view in ejb interceptor / servlet listener addition.
Modified: projects/webbeans-ri-int/trunk/microcontainer/src/main/java/org/jboss/webbeans/integration/microcontainer/deployer/metadata/PostWebMetadataDeployer.java
===================================================================
--- projects/webbeans-ri-int/trunk/microcontainer/src/main/java/org/jboss/webbeans/integration/microcontainer/deployer/metadata/PostWebMetadataDeployer.java 2009-01-07 16:30:40 UTC (rev 82665)
+++ projects/webbeans-ri-int/trunk/microcontainer/src/main/java/org/jboss/webbeans/integration/microcontainer/deployer/metadata/PostWebMetadataDeployer.java 2009-01-07 17:18:25 UTC (rev 82666)
@@ -25,6 +25,7 @@
import java.util.List;
import org.jboss.deployers.spi.DeploymentException;
+import org.jboss.deployers.spi.deployer.DeploymentStages;
import org.jboss.deployers.vfs.spi.structure.VFSDeploymentUnit;
import org.jboss.metadata.web.jboss.JBossWebMetaData;
import org.jboss.metadata.web.spec.ListenerMetaData;
@@ -44,6 +45,8 @@
{
super(JBossWebMetaData.class);
addInput(JBossWebBeansMetaData.WEB_BEANS_FILES);
+ addInput("merged." + JBossWebMetaData.class.getName());
+ setStage(DeploymentStages.POST_CLASSLOADER);
setOptionalWebBeansXml(true);
// create wbl listener
WBL = new ListenerMetaData();
Modified: projects/webbeans-ri-int/trunk/microcontainer/src/main/java/org/jboss/webbeans/integration/microcontainer/deployer/metadata/WBEjbInterceptorMetadataDeployer.java
===================================================================
--- projects/webbeans-ri-int/trunk/microcontainer/src/main/java/org/jboss/webbeans/integration/microcontainer/deployer/metadata/WBEjbInterceptorMetadataDeployer.java 2009-01-07 16:30:40 UTC (rev 82665)
+++ projects/webbeans-ri-int/trunk/microcontainer/src/main/java/org/jboss/webbeans/integration/microcontainer/deployer/metadata/WBEjbInterceptorMetadataDeployer.java 2009-01-07 17:18:25 UTC (rev 82666)
@@ -46,11 +46,11 @@
public WBEjbInterceptorMetadataDeployer()
{
addInput(EjbJarMetaData.class);
- addOutput(EjbJarMetaData.class);
addInput(JBossMetaData.class);
addOutput(JBossMetaData.class);
addInput(JBossWebBeansMetaData.WEB_BEANS_FILES);
- setStage(DeploymentStages.POST_PARSE);
+ addInput("merged." + JBossMetaData.class.getName());
+ setStage(DeploymentStages.POST_CLASSLOADER);
// create interceptor metadata instance
SBI = new InterceptorMetaData();
SBI.setInterceptorClass("org.jboss.webbeans.ejb.SessionBeanInterceptor");
More information about the jboss-cvs-commits
mailing list